The Annual Dean's Concert returns with all the glamour and musical excellence that make it one of the University of Johannesburg’s most anticipated cultural events. Presented by UJ Arts & Culture, a division of the Faculty of Art, Design and Architecture (FADA), and led by Professor Federico Freschi, Executive Dean of FADA, this year’s concert holds special significance as it celebrates the University of Johannesburg’s 20th anniversary.
Affectionately known as the “Singing Dean”, Professor Freschi once again joins forces with acclaimed pianist and composer Christopher Duigan to direct an unforgettable evening of music. The programme introduces fresh new voices alongside much-loved favourites, offering audiences a rich and diverse musical experience.
Adding international sparkle, Cape Town-born soprano Yolisa Ngwexana takes to the stage, while the award-winning UJ Choir, a cornerstone of UJ Arts & Culture, delivers its signature blend of versatility and vocal excellence.
